MEMO — Kettling Depot Receiving

Uniform sets for the new Kettling depot arrive Wednesday via Ashgrove courier: 40 boxes, sorted by size, manifest attached to box one. Check the count at the dock before signing; shortages go straight to stores, not the courier. The hand-over instruction the courier will follow is set out below.

drop instructions, tafof-baguf: the holmir gilox courier leaves the sormir ulaok holdor ledger at gate 5596 under passcode 257343

LiftSim, our elevator-dispatch simulator, runs in three environments: dev, staging, and perf. Dev uses a single-building scenario with synthetic passenger traffic; staging mirrors the full Harbrook Tower model; perf runs sustained peak-load scenarios for dispatcher tuning. Future maintainers should note that staging and perf intentionally diverge in tick rate and car count, so never copy settings between them blindly. Each environment reads its settings at startup from a mounted file, and staging currently uses the following values.

service settings:
[istael]
port = 5000
region = north-1
host = istael.qirvancorp.internal
timeout_ms = 500
retries = 6

Handover note — Crumbwheel order cutoffs.

Welcome aboard. The bakery cutoff rule in Crumbwheel closes same-day orders at 14:00 local to each storefront, not UTC — this has bitten us twice. Holiday overrides live in the calendar service and take precedence silently, so always check there first when a cutoff looks wrong. To unlock the calendar service's admin console after a restart, enter the recovery passphrase below.

vault phrase of bagap-bahaf = silion-pelox-sorox-casdor-quenwyn-fraax-eliox-praael-kelion-quenvan-kasox-rusael-norius-belvan

Subject: Quickstore 4.2 — bloom filter now fronts the KV layer

Plugin authors: starting with this release, Quickstore places a bloom filter ahead of the key-value store. Negative lookups return faster; false positives fall through safely. No API changes are required on your side. Verify your plugin against the staging build referenced below.

session token of fahif-tadup = htk3_9c7